Enigmatica 9: Expert - E9E

Enigmatica 9: Expert - E9E

135k Downloads

The server hangs silently if you block a Pillager's attack with an shield while you have anything in your main hand

hezamu opened this issue ยท 1 comments

commented

Modpack Version

1.5.0

Describe your issue.

Steps to reproduce:

  1. Create a new world (I don't think the parameters matter, but I used seed 0 and allow cheats.)
  2. /gamemode creative
  3. Get a shield, a sword and a Pillager spawn egg.
  4. /gamemode survival
  5. Equip shield in offhand, sword in mainhand
  6. Spawn the pillager
  7. Block the pillager's attack with your shield --> server freezes.

Some notes

  • Noticed on a survival server but easy to reproduce in singleplayer.
  • Tried with a Skeleton as well, no issues, the problem is with Pillagers.
  • Any shield offhand and any item in main hand will work.
  • The problem does not crash the server, everything stays frozen until the tick watchdog kills the server.
  • A multiplayer server does not report anything into latest.log, You may see [spark-asyncsampler-worker-thread/WARN] [spark/]: Timed out waiting for world statistics in the logs at some point before the watchdog kicks in, but this is not the cause of the problem.
  • You can't even exit the single player game afterwards normally as the "Saving world" phase will freeze the client permanently, you have to kill the client with the task manager.

Crash Report

No response

Latest Log

No response

Have you modified the modpack?

No

User Modifications

No response

Did the issue happen in singleplayer or on a server?

Both

Discord Username

hezamu

commented

Thanks for the report. This is the same as #270.